What Is Systemic Aleukemic Reticuloendotheliosis?

Systemic Aleukemic Reticuloendotheliosis (SAR) is a rare and complex hematological disorder characterized by the proliferation of reticuloendothelial cells, which are part of the immune system. This condition primarily affects the bone marrow and the lymphatic system, leading to a range of systemic symptoms. Unlike other forms of reticuloendotheliosis, SAR is distinguished by the absence of significant leukocytosis (an increase in white blood cells), hence the term “aleukemic.” This unique feature makes it particularly challenging to diagnose and manage.

The Mechanism Behind SAR

The exact cause of Systemic Aleukemic Reticuloendotheliosis remains largely unknown, but it is believed to involve a combination of genetic and environmental factors. The disorder leads to the abnormal growth of reticuloendothelial cells, which can infiltrate various organs, including the liver, spleen, and lymph nodes. This infiltration can disrupt normal organ function and lead to a cascade of symptoms that can significantly impact a patient’s quality of life.

Who Is Affected?

While SAR can occur in individuals of any age, it is most commonly diagnosed in adults. The condition is rare, and its prevalence is not well-documented, making it a challenge for healthcare providers to recognize and treat effectively. Early diagnosis is crucial for improving outcomes, but due to its rarity, many healthcare professionals may not be familiar with the condition.

Symptoms of Systemic Aleukemic Reticuloendotheliosis

The symptoms of Systemic Aleukemic Reticuloendotheliosis can vary widely among individuals, often depending on the extent of organ involvement. Here are some of the most common symptoms associated with this condition:

  • Fatigue: Many patients report persistent fatigue that does not improve with rest.
  • Fever: Unexplained fevers may occur, often accompanied by chills and night sweats.
  • Weight Loss: Unintentional weight loss is common, which can be distressing for patients.
  • Splenomegaly: Enlargement of the spleen is a hallmark sign, leading to discomfort and a feeling of fullness.
  • Hepatomegaly: Liver enlargement can also occur, potentially causing abdominal pain or discomfort.
  • Skin Changes: Some patients may experience skin rashes or lesions as a result of the disease.
  • Bone Pain: Pain in the bones or joints can be a significant symptom, affecting mobility and quality of life.

Causes and Risk Factors

Systemic Aleukemic Reticuloendotheliosis (SARE) is a rare and complex condition that primarily affects the reticuloendothelial system, which plays a crucial role in the immune response. Understanding the causes and risk factors associated with SARE is essential for early detection and management.

Genetic Factors

One of the primary causes of SARE may be linked to genetic predispositions. Certain genetic mutations can affect the body’s ability to produce and regulate blood cells, leading to the development of this condition. While specific genes have not been definitively identified, a family history of blood disorders may increase the risk of developing SARE.

Environmental Exposures

Environmental factors can also play a significant role in the onset of SARE. Exposure to certain chemicals, toxins, or radiation may contribute to the development of this condition. For instance, individuals who have worked in industries with high levels of chemical exposure may be at a greater risk. 🌍

Infections

Some infections have been associated with the development of SARE. Viral infections, particularly those that affect the immune system, can trigger an abnormal response in the reticuloendothelial system. This can lead to the symptoms and complications associated with SARE. Common viral infections that may be linked include:

  • HIV
  • Hepatitis B and C
  • Epstein-Barr virus (EBV)

Autoimmune Disorders

Individuals with autoimmune disorders may also be at an increased risk for developing SARE. Conditions such as lupus or rheumatoid arthritis can lead to an overactive immune response, which may inadvertently affect the reticuloendothelial system. This can result in the symptoms characteristic of SARE, including fatigue, fever, and lymphadenopathy.

Age and Gender

Age and gender are also important factors to consider. SARE is more commonly diagnosed in adults, particularly those over the age of 50. Additionally, some studies suggest that men may be at a higher risk than women, although the reasons for this disparity are not yet fully understood.

Diagnosis of Systemic Aleukemic Reticuloendotheliosis

Diagnosing Systemic Aleukemic Reticuloendotheliosis can be challenging due to its rarity and the overlap of symptoms with other conditions. A comprehensive approach is necessary to ensure an accurate diagnosis.

Clinical Evaluation

The first step in diagnosing SARE typically involves a thorough clinical evaluation. Healthcare providers will review the patient’s medical history, including any symptoms experienced, family history of blood disorders, and potential environmental exposures. Common symptoms that may prompt further investigation include:

  • Unexplained fever
  • Fatigue
  • Swollen lymph nodes
  • Weight loss

Blood Tests

Blood tests are crucial in the diagnostic process. A complete blood count (CBC) may reveal abnormalities in blood cell levels, such as low white blood cell counts, which is characteristic of SARE. Additionally, tests to assess liver function and other organ systems may be conducted to rule out other potential causes of the symptoms.

Bone Marrow Biopsy

A bone marrow biopsy is often necessary to confirm a diagnosis of SARE. This procedure involves taking a small sample of bone marrow, usually from the hip bone, to examine the cells present. In SARE, the bone marrow may show signs of infiltration by abnormal cells, which can help differentiate it from other hematological disorders.

Imaging Studies

Imaging studies, such as CT scans or MRIs, may be utilized to assess the extent of lymphadenopathy or organ involvement. These imaging techniques can provide valuable information about the condition of the reticuloendothelial system and help guide treatment decisions.

Consultation with Specialists

Given the complexity of SARE, consultation with specialists, such as hematologists or oncologists, may be necessary for a definitive diagnosis and to develop an appropriate treatment plan. These experts can provide insights into the latest research and treatment options available for managing this rare condition.

Complications and Prognosis

Systemic Aleukemic Reticuloendotheliosis (SARE) is a rare and complex condition that can lead to a variety of complications. Understanding these complications is crucial for both patients and healthcare providers to manage the disease effectively.

Understanding the Complications

SARE primarily affects the reticuloendothelial system, which plays a vital role in the immune response. The complications associated with this condition can be severe and may include:

  • Infection Risk: Due to the compromised immune system, patients with SARE are at a heightened risk for infections. This can lead to recurrent illnesses that may require hospitalization.
  • Hematological Issues: Patients may experience anemia, thrombocytopenia (low platelet count), and leukopenia (low white blood cell count), which can complicate treatment and recovery.
  • Organ Dysfunction: The disease can affect various organs, leading to dysfunction in the liver, spleen, and lymph nodes, which may require careful monitoring and management.
  • Secondary Malignancies: There is a potential risk for developing secondary cancers due to the underlying disease and its treatment.

Prognosis for Patients with SARE

The prognosis for individuals diagnosed with Systemic Aleukemic Reticuloendotheliosis can vary significantly based on several factors, including:

  • Early Diagnosis: Early detection and intervention can improve outcomes. Patients diagnosed in the early stages may have a better prognosis.
  • Response to Treatment: The effectiveness of treatment regimens, which may include chemotherapy or immunotherapy, plays a critical role in determining the prognosis.
  • Overall Health: The patient’s overall health and presence of comorbid conditions can influence recovery and long-term outcomes.

While some patients may experience a favorable prognosis with appropriate treatment, others may face significant challenges. Regular follow-ups and a multidisciplinary approach to care are essential for managing complications and improving quality of life. 🌟
